HENSLEY v. ATTORNEY GENERAL

Nos. SJC-12106, SJC-12117.

474 Mass. 651 (2016)

JOSEPHINE HENSLEY & others v. ATTORNEY GENERAL & another. MATTHEW JOHN ALLEN & others v. ATTORNEY GENERAL & another.

Supreme Judicial Court of Massachusetts, Suffolk.

July 6, 2016.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John S. Scheft for Josephine Hensley & others.

Robert E. Toone , Assistant Attorney General, for the defendants.

Thomas R. Kiley for Matthew John Allen & others.

David G. Evans , of New Jersey, for Massachusetts Hospital Association & others, amici curiae, submitted a brief.

Present: GANTS, C.J., SPINA, CORDY, BOTSFORD, DUFFLY, LENK, & HINES, JJ.


We have before us two cases involving an initiative petition that, if approved by the voters in the November, 2016, election, would legalize, regulate, and tax marijuana and products that contain marijuana concentrate.
